California-based MC, singer, and songwriter Zachary Campos delivers a highly calculated freestyle in his new jam “Precision,” a tribute to his late dog, Juni.

Based out of San Jose, California, Zachary Campos is a man of many talents. His music transcends religion, culture, economics, politics, race, and gender. His authenticity and relatability also resonate with music fanatics who appreciate originality and creativity. His vocal versatility allows him to adapt to various styles and beats without ever losing his magnetic charm. His sonic work is an exploration of the rich tapestry of old-school hip-hop, golden age punk rock, and nostalgic indie rock. Backed by his intricate storytelling capabilities, Campos emerges as a complete artist with an uncanny ability to paint the human soul with raw words. How about that!

He returns with a new freestyled masterpiece, “Precision,” showcasing his versatility and intelligence by delivering flawlessly from start to finish, without pausing for even a breath or blink.

A tribute to his late dog Juni, who passed away at age 16, this song is as much a celebration of a life well-lived as it is a tribute to Juni’s enduring legacy, which will forever remain with Zachary. It is also a timely reminder for us to be content and grateful for where we are in life.

Let’s talk about that slick production, shall we? The programmed drums and guitar riffs lend the song a rock feel, while the turntable scratches introduce elegance to the mix. The blend of rhythm and melody is super funky, laying a steady foundation for Zachary’s distinct vocal delivery.

Inspired by old-school beats, the song allows Zachary’s impeccable skills on the mic to shine.
